@import url(nav.css);

body { color: #d7d7d7; font-size: 12px; font-family: Arial, Helvetica, Geneva, SunSans-Regular, sans-serif; behavior: url('csshover.htc'); background-color: #414141; background-image: url(../images/background.jpg); margin: 0; padding: 0; }

p { margin-top: 10px; margin-bottom: 10px; }
a { color: #fff; }
a:hover { text-decoration: none; }
#all { width: 799px; margin-top: 12px; margin-right: auto; margin-left: auto; border: solid 1px #fff; }
/*<agl.folder "top">*/
	#top-strip { background-color: #9d523f; height: 19px; }
	#top-btn-member { background-image: url(../images/member-area.gif); width: 124px; height: 19px; float: left; cursor: pointer; }
	#top-tee-times { background-image: url(../images/tee-times.gif); width: 203px; height: 19px; float: right; }
/*</agl.folder>*/
#flash { height: 283px; border-top: 1px solid #fff; border-bottom: 1px solid #fff; }
#nav-fade { background-image: url(../images/nav-fade.gif); height: 5px; overflow: hidden; }
#nav-fade-full { background-image: url(../images/nav-fade-full.gif); height: 5px; overflow: hidden; }
#container { background-color: #9d523f; background-image: url(../images/container-rpt.gif); padding-bottom: 7px; }
#container-full { background-color: #9d523f; background-image: url(../images/container2-rpt.gif); padding-bottom: 7px; }
/*<agl.folder "column">*/
	#column { width: 190px; float: left; margin-right: 35px; margin-left: 20px; display: inline; }
	#col-tee-times { background-image: url(../images/left-col-tee-times.gif); width: 190px; height: 57px; }
	#col-egolf { background-image: url(../images/left-col-egolf.gif); width: 190px; height: 73px; cursor: pointer; }
	#col-member { background-image: url(../images/left-col-member=area.gif); width: 190px; height: 66px; cursor: pointer; }
	#col-bluegreen { background-image: url(../images/left-col-bluegreen.gif); width: 190px; height: 67px; cursor: pointer; }
/*</agl.folder>*/
#main { background-image: url(../images/main-rpt.gif); text-align: justify; width: 515px; float: left; margin-top: 13px; border-bottom: 1px solid #a7a5a5; }
#main-full { text-align: justify; margin-right: 22px; margin-left: 20px; padding-top: 13px; padding-right: 18px; padding-left: 18px; }
#pageheader2 { width: 514px; height: 62px; float: left; }
#pageheader { width: 304px; height: 62px; float: left; }
#signature-course { background-image: url(../images/sig.gif); background-repeat: no-repeat; width: 211px; height: 62px; float: right; }
#main-image { position: relative; top: -18px; width: 153px; height: 109px; float: right; margin-bottom: -16px; margin-left: 10px; }
#main-image-filler { margin-bottom: -16px; margin-left: 10px; width: 153px; float: right; }
#main-left-strip { background-color: #903c29; background-image: url(../images/main-left-strip.gif); background-repeat: no-repeat; background-position: 0 27px; width: 2px; height: 163px; float: left; margin-right: -2px; }
.mainpad { line-height: 15px; padding-right: 10px; padding-left: 17px; }
.mainpad2 { line-height: 15px; padding-right: 8px; padding-left: 5px; }
.mainpad-left { line-height: 15px; float: left; padding-right: 10px; padding-left: 17px; }
/*<agl.folder "footer">*/
	#footer { background-color: #9d523f; height: 38px; }
	#footerpad { color: #fff; font-size: 11px; line-height: 38px; padding-right: 22px; padding-left: 20px; }
	#footer a { color: #fff; text-decoration: none; }
	#clickit { float: right; }
/*</agl.folder>*/
/*<agl.folder "pdfbox">*/
	#pdfbox { font-weight: bold; line-height: 24px; float: right; margin-bottom: 6px; margin-left: 12px; border: solid 1px #a7a7a7; }
	#pdfbox ul { background-color: #561000; margin: 1px; padding: 8px 12px; list-style-type: none; }
	#pdfbox li { border-bottom: 1px dotted #a7a7a7; }
	#pdfbox li.end { border-bottom-width: 0; }
	#pdfbox a { color: #fff; text-decoration: none; }
	#pdfbox a:hover { color: #cbcbcb; }
/*</agl.folder>*/
/*<agl.folder "table styles">*/
	.rates { color: #333; background-color: #cbcbcb; text-align: left; clear: right; border: solid 1px #742b1a; }
	.rates-gray { background-color: #d7d7d7; }
	.rates-header { color: #fff; background-color: #561000; }
/*</agl.folder>*/
/*<agl.folder "font sytles">*/
	.tbig { font-size: 14px; font-weight: bold; }
	.tbigu { font-size: 14px; font-weight: bold; text-decoration: underline; }
/*</agl.folder>*/
/*<agl.folder "clears">*/
	.clearleft { clear: left; }
	.clearfix:after {
    content: "."; 
    display: block; 
    height: 0; 
    clear: both; 
    visibility: hidden;
}
	.clearfix {display: inline-block;}
	/* Hides from IE-mac \*/
	* html .clearfix {height: 1%;}
	.clearfix {display: block;}
	/* End hide from IE-mac */
/*</agl.folder>*/

